Analytical Sociology amidst a Computational Social Science Revolution
As CSS and AS have matured, obvious connections between them have emerged. Both are
keenly interested in complexity and emergence, whereby “the behavior of entities at one ‘scale’
of reality is not easily traced to the properties of the entities at the scale below” (Watts, 2013,
p. 6; see also Anderson, 1972)
